Carrier and DMERC 835
Flat File Change and Replacement of Deactivated Reason Code
A2
|
Note: This article
was revised on December 6, 2004, to show that the
deactivation of Reason Code A2 also applies to Medicare
carriers.
|
Provider Types
Affected
All providers who submit claims to
Medicare carriers, including durable medical equipment regional
carriers (DMERCs)
Provider Action Needed
Impact to You
This one-time notification informs you of the Deactivation of
Reason Code A2 for carriers and DMERCs.
What You Need to Know
Providers should be aware of the corrected companion document
and the deactivated reason code.
What You Need to Do
Be
aware that reason code A2 is being replaced by reason code 121
(Indemnification Adjustment) as of January 3, 2005.
Background
CR 2657 has
changed the 835 flat file for carriers and DMERCs to
accommodate quantity in metric units, which may have up to
seven numeric positions and up to three decimal points. The
updated flat file is posted at: http://www.cms.hhs.gov/providers/edi/hipaadoc.asp
In addition, as noted above and effective as
of January 1, 2005, reason code A2 will be replaced by reason
code 121 (Indemnification Adjustment) on remittance
advices.
